STATUS ALWAYS ON, 2 SECONDS, ALWAYS OFF
Controls the activation of the on-screen display when the display
device is connected to a Main Zone video output connector. When
ALWAYS ON is selected, the on-screen display remains activated at

all times. When 2 SECONDS is selected, the on-screen display
activates for two seconds whenever a new input source is present
or a new command is received. When ALWAYS OFF is selected, the
on-screen display remains deactivated at all times, and will not
reactivate until the STATUS parameter is reset to ALWAYS ON or 2
SECONDS.
Note:
When the ON-SCREEN DISPLAY menu STATUS
parameter is set to ALWAYS OFF, the on-screen display
immediately deactivates. Press the OSD button or use
the front panel display as a guide to reset the
ON-SCREEN DISPLAY menu STATUS parameter to
ALWAYS ON or 2 SECONDS.
